New 'KISS' Portrait made with M-A-C Turns your Lips into a Custom Masterpiece

Published in Health Business Week, November 23rd, 2007

DNA 11, the creators of custom portraits made from your DNA and fingerprints, launches its new line of modern art pieces called KISS Portraits(TM) made with M-A-C's VIVA GLAM lipstick. The KISS portrait is unveiled at www.dna11.com, the new state-of-the art website that allows complete customization with extensive customer interaction. A portion of sales will be donated to the M-A-C AIDS Fund.
